How to plan a trip to Delhi Agra and Jaipur
The well-known Golden Triangle in India is made up of Delhi, Agra, and Jaipur. This popular tourist route highlights India’s rich history, culture, and architecture. These three urban communities offer a brief look into India’s at various times and are an ideal objective for voyagers who need to encounter India’s variety. Jaipur is a city in the Indian state of Rajasthan. It is also known as the “Pink City.” The magnificent palaces, vibrant markets, and extensive cultural heritage of this beautiful city are all well-known.
